PHP 5 Misc.関数

❮ 前章へ 次章へ ❯

PHP その他の概要

misc.関数は、他のカテゴリのどれにも当てはまらないため、ここに配置しています。


インストール

misc.関数は、PHPコアの一部です。 これらの機能を使用するためのインストールは不要です。


実行時設定

misc.関数のの動作は、php.iniファイルの設定の影響を受けます。

Misc.の設定オプション:

名前 説明 デフォルト 変更可能
ignore_user_abort FALSEは、クライアントが接続を中断した後で、何かを出力しようとするとすぐにスクリプトが終了することを表します "0" PHP_INI_ALL
highlight.string PHP構文で文字列を強調表示するための色 "#DD0000" PHP_INI_ALL
highlight.comment PHPコメントを強調表示するための色 "#FF8000" PHP_INI_ALL
highlight.keyword PHP構文でキーワード(括弧やセミコロンなど)を強調表示するための色 "#007700" PHP_INI_ALL
highlight.bg PHP 5.4.0で削除されました。背景色 "#FFFFFF" PHP_INI_ALL
highlight.default PHP構文のデフォルトの色 "#0000BB" PHP_INI_ALL
highlight.html HTMLコードの色 "#000000" PHP_INI_ALL
browscap browser-capabilitiesファイルの名前と場所(browscap.iniなど) NULL PHP_INI_SYSTEM

PHP その他の関数

関数 説明
connection_aborted() クライアントが切断されているかどうかをチェックする
connection_status() 現在の接続状態を返す
connection_timeout() PHP 4.0.5では非推奨。 スクリプトがタイムアウトしたかどうかをチェックする
constant() 定数の値を返す
define() 定数を定義する
defined() 定数が存在するかどうかをチェックする
die() メッセージを出力し、現在のスクリプトを終了する
eval() 文字列をPHPコードとして評価する
exit() メッセージを出力し、現在のスクリプトを終了する
get_browser() ユーザのブラウザの機能を返す
__halt_compiler() コンパイラの実行を停止する
highlight_file() PHP構文を強調表示したファイルを出力する
highlight_string() PHP構文を強調表示した文字列を出力する
ignore_user_abort() リモートのクライアントがスクリプトの実行を中止できるかどうかを設定する
pack() データをバイナリ文字列にパックする
php_check_syntax() PHP 5.0.5で非推奨
php_strip_whitespace() PHPのコメントと空白を削除したファイルのソースコードを返す
show_source() highlight_file()のエイリアス
sleep() コード実行を数秒間遅延させる
sys_getloadavg() システムの平均負荷を取得する
time_nanosleep() コード実行を秒やナノ秒単位で遅延させる
time_sleep_until() 指定した時間までコード実行を遅延させる
uniqid() 一意なIDを生成する
unpack() バイナリ文字列からデータをアンパックする
usleep() コード実行を数マイクロ秒間遅延させる

PHP 5 定義済み Misc. 定数

PHP: 定数をサポートするPHPの最も古いバージョンを表します。

定数 説明 PHP
CONNECTION_ABORTED    
CONNECTION_NORMAL    
CONNECTION_TIMEOUT    
__COMPILER_HALT_OFFSET__   5

❮ 前章へ 次章へ ❯